The San Francisco Zoological Society is a non-profit institution that manages and raises funds for San Francisco Zoo and Gardens. The Society’s mission is to connect visitors with wildlife so that they care about nature and ultimately conserve it. SUMMARY : The Society employs animal care professionals, including animal keepers, to care for animals at the Zoo. An Animal Keeper has responsibility for the care, welfare, and safety of an animal(s) and the animal’s habitat or exhibit. 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ES : An Animal Keeper performs all aspects of animal care, including upkeep of exhibits and adjacent areas, minor and emergency repairs to exhibits, designing and building displays and exhibit changes, conducting tours, public speaking, and coordinating volunteers. Cleans and maintains enclosures, cages, stalls, moats, barns, pools, yards, roads, and related areas. Observes behavior of animals, notes any unusual behavior, signs of illness or injury, and reports to supervisor or animal management team. Answers questions and gives information regarding animals, Zoo operations, and Zoo exhibits to the visiting public. Assists in the crating and uncrating of animals, catches and restrains as necessary, and may assist in transfer between locations. Designs and builds displays within existing enclosures and assists with planning and care of landscaped areas. Interacts with Zoo visitors and staff courteously and offers proper attention at all times. Drives vehicles on or off Zoo grounds and possesses knowledge of an animal’s dietary needs. Collaborates with other Zoo departments to maintain the highest level of animal care.
